Re: RAF100
Far too early for any details but I have been advised that planning is underway for displays at RIAT2018, Cosford, somewhere in Wales and a static display on Horse Guards Parade, London, with a huge flypast down the Mall. The official 100th Anniversary date is 1st April 2018, but that's Easter Sunday, so I think there will be something planned 100 days after that, sometime in July.
